Match Summary

Corinthians defeated Sao Paulo 6:1. The match was played in Serie A 2015. Goals were scored by Bruno Henrique 27′, Á. Romero 29′, Edu Dracena 45′, Lucca 61′, Á. Romero 64′, Carlinhos 70′, Cristian 76′ (pen.). 4 yellow cards were shown. Corinthians had 50% possession while Sao Paulo held 50%. Corinthians had 13 shots (10 on target) compared to 19 (5 on target) for Sao Paulo. Corinthians made 3 substitutions, Sao Paulo made 3.
